Web1 de fev. de 2024 · More specifically, the camera is always located at the eye space coordinate (0.0, 0.0, 0.0). To give the appearance of moving the camera, your OpenGL application must move the scene with the inverse of the camera transformation by placing it on the MODELVIEW matrix. WebTherefore, we have to keep in mind that both clipping (frustum culling) and NDC transformations are integrated into GL_PROJECTION matrix.The following sections describe how to build the projection matrix from 6 parameters; left, right, bottom, top, near and far boundary values. Transform Feedback is the process of capturing Primitives generated by the Vertex Processing step (s), recording data from those primitives into Buffer Objects. This allows one to preserve the post-transform rendering state of an object and resubmit this data multiple times. chaire fiscali
